Supreme Court Seeks Response On Nationwide Child Trafficking Mechanism

The Supreme Court is considering a request to improve how child kidnapping and trafficking cases are handled across India.

The request asks for the same investigation rules everywhere.

It also asks police to investigate quickly and courts to hold speedy trials.

Lawyer Ashwini Upadhyay said children are trafficked for many kinds of exploitation.

These include forced work, begging, child marriage and other crimes.

He also said some children are abducted for forced conversion.

The judges noted that government programs already exist to deal with these problems.

The Court has now asked the Centre and other authorities to respond.

Key facts

Court
Supreme Court of India
Bench
Chief Justice of India Surya Kant and Justices Joymalya Bagchi and V Mohana
Petition type
Public interest litigation
Requested action
A uniform nationwide mechanism, time-bound investigations and speedy trials
Authorities notified
The Centre, state governments and other concerned authorities
Trafficking concerns cited
Sexual exploitation, forced labour, begging, petty crimes, armed conflict, child marriage and child labour
Related proceedings
An existing case monitoring FIR registration in missing-person cases
